I gather from his name he is a pretty big fan of the composer Giacomo Meyerbeer. The jewish Meyerbeer used to be a friend and mentor to Wagner, before Wagner turned against him and started writing nasty polemics against Jewish composers. Apart from Meyerbeer, this also included Mendelssohn.
